Chester Lian
3×3 · top 5.4% of 284,439 all-time · competing since February 2009 · 2009LIAN03
Chester Lian has been competing for 18 years. His best event is the 3×3: a personal-best single of 9.23, set at Duke Summer 2016, puts him in the top 5.4% of the 284,439 people who have ever been ranked in the event, and 271st in Malaysia. Until February 2008, no official 3×3 solve in the world had been that fast. Across 41 competitions since February 2009, he has put 1,724 official solves on the record across 16 events. Solve to solve, his 3×3 times vary about 12% around a typical one, steadier than 80% of the 35,811 competitors with ten or more counted rounds. His 3×3 best has come down from 12.77 in February 2009 to 9.23, a 28% improvement. Chester has entered 41 competitions, more competitions than 99% of everyone who has ever competed.

Reading this page: a single is one solve's time · an average is the middle three of five solves, best and worst discarded · a PB is a personal best · a DNF (did not finish) is an attempt with no valid result: a popped piece, an unsolved face, an over-limit memorisation · top X% compares against everyone ever ranked in that event, which is fairer than raw rank because event pools differ tenfold.
